Subject: [PATCH v3 01/13] locks: add new struct list_head to struct file_lock

From: Jeff Layton <jlayton@...marydata.com>

...that we can use to queue file_locks to per-ctx list_heads. Go ahead
and convert locks_delete_lock and locks_dispose_list to use it instead
of the fl_block list.

Signed-off-by: Jeff Layton <jlayton@...marydata.com>
Acked-by: Christoph Hellwig <hch@....de>
---
 fs/locks.c         | 8 +++++---
 include/linux/fs.h | 1 +
 2 files changed, 6 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/fs/locks.c b/fs/locks.c
index 59e2f905e4ff..bfe5f17401de 100644
--- a/fs/locks.c
+++ b/fs/locks.c
@@ -207,6 +207,7 @@ static struct kmem_cache *filelock_cache __read_mostly;
 static void locks_init_lock_heads(struct file_lock *fl)
 {
 	INIT_HLIST_NODE(&fl->fl_link);
+	INIT_LIST_HEAD(&fl->fl_list);
 	INIT_LIST_HEAD(&fl->fl_block);
 	init_waitqueue_head(&fl->fl_wait);
 }
@@ -243,6 +244,7 @@ E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(locks_release_private);
 void locks_free_lock(struct file_lock *fl)
 {
 	BUG_ON(waitqueue_active(&fl->fl_wait));
+	BUG_ON(!list_empty(&fl->fl_list));
 	BUG_ON(!list_empty(&fl->fl_block));
 	BUG_ON(!hlist_unhashed(&fl->fl_link));
 
@@ -257,8 +259,8 @@ locks_dispose_list(struct list_head *dispose)
 	struct file_lock *fl;
 
 	while (!list_empty(dispose)) {
-		fl = list_first_entry(dispose, struct file_lock, fl_block);
-		list_del_init(&fl->fl_block);
+		fl = list_first_entry(dispose, struct file_lock, fl_list);
+		list_del_init(&fl->fl_list);
 		locks_free_lock(fl);
 	}
 }
@@ -691,7 +693,7 @@ static void locks_delete_lock(struct file_lock **thisfl_p,
 
 	locks_unlink_lock(thisfl_p);
 	if (dispose)
-		list_add(&fl->fl_block, dispose);
+		list_add(&fl->fl_list, dispose);
 	else
 		locks_free_lock(fl);
 }
diff --git a/include/linux/fs.h b/include/linux/fs.h
index 42efe13077b6..cd6818115162 100644
--- a/include/linux/fs.h
+++ b/include/linux/fs.h
@@ -934,6 +934,7 @@ int locks_in_grace(struct net *);
  */
 struct file_lock {
 	struct file_lock *fl_next;	/* singly linked list for this inode  */
+	struct list_head fl_list;	/* link into file_lock_context */
 	struct hlist_node fl_link;	/* node in global lists */
 	struct list_head fl_block;	/* circular list of blocked processes */
 	fl_owner_t fl_owner;
